The Seventh Seal (Criterion)

Ok this has to be the weirdest movie ive ever took the time to fully watch. But after giving it my full attention i understood and appreciated its value and meaning. Very intelligent in the deliverance of this movie. A Knight (Antonius Block) that has lost his faith in god and the devil and is very curious to find out if any of it is real.

His partner who just see's 1's and 0's and its pretty hilarious and a very truthful but in a dark way. A very logical character and his handmaiden is beautiful BTW lol.

This movie has a sweet twisted ending and makes you think of religion deeply. I loved the movie and it ended perfectly, but i know there's things i missed i might catch it on a 2nd viewing or just watch the special features .

Now i do believe the only negative to this film is that character development was a little too much, making the film a bit boring at the beginning.


4.5/5

One more thing id like to add is that EVERY character in the movie is in relation to the people that you meet day to day. Very unique. The Knight(Questions God/Religion) His Partner(Believes in fate) The Blacksmith(Weak Minded) The Young Handmaiden (Deceitful) The Jester(Fully Engaged with his Beliefs).

Once again i thought the movie was amazing but if they spent less time on character development i would of gave it a perfect 5
